She was, you know, on a popular morning show recently, and she let everyone in on a little secret: a certain sweet item from Trader Joe's has completely captured her affection, especially for when she's got company. This particular item, a warm French Apple Tart from Trader Joe's, was served at a dinner she hosted, and it was, well, truly delicious, according to her. It’s not a fancy, boozy concoction, which is interesting, that. It's just a straightforward, lovely dessert that seems to hit all the right notes for both hosts and guests.

So, whether you often have folks visit or just truly enjoy a good apple tart, this insight from Ina Garten herself might just make your life a little easier, and certainly a lot tastier. It’s a seasonal item, so you might want to look for it soon, as it won't be around forever, more or less. This tart, which is currently available for around $7.99, is made with sweet Northern Spy apples, giving it a delightful taste that apparently resonates even with a culinary icon like Ina.

Where Can You Find Ina Garten's Trader Joe's Dessert?

The Trader Joe’s French Apple Tart is a seasonal offering, meaning it's not always available. This "limited time offering" status, actually, adds a bit of urgency for those who want to try Ina Garten's Trader Joe's dessert of choice. Trader Joe's is known for these unique, delightful treats that often become fan favorites, and this tart is clearly one of them. You'll typically find it in the frozen dessert section, ready to be taken home and warmed up.

Given its popularity and seasonal nature, if you see it, it might be a good idea to pick one up. It’s currently being sold for $7.99, which is a pretty good price for a dessert that has received such high praise. The website labels it as a limited product, which almost certainly means it won't be on shelves year-round. So, if you're looking to try this simple but surprisingly delicious Ina Garten's Trader Joe's dessert, keeping an eye out during the colder months is probably your best bet, that.
